Notifications

3 views

Description

Non-admin users are not able to see articles in the Knowledge Homepage.

When opening a knowledge base from the Knowledge homepage, the loading icon is shown on the content list but no articles are loaded.

An error is displayed on the browser's console:

TypeError: Cannot read property 'replace' of undefined

Release or Environment

Kingston Patch 6

Cause

The angular processor that handles the contextual search on the knowledge base, ContextSearchService, has an execute ACL that is filtering the users to specific roles. This ACL is bypassed for admin users that is why also admin users can see it. 

Resolution

Add the necessary roles on the angular processors ACLs.

Article Information

Last Updated:2020-02-13 06:59:48
Published:2020-02-13